Hey everyone. I have some questions about how AWX handles nested yaml values for things like surveys.
I have a nested yaml declaration in previous playbook for group_vars, and they look like this: # OS API User Login Information: auth: os_auth_url: "http://openstack.domain.io5:5000" os_username: "username" # OS Project Details: project: os_project: "admin" os_region_name: "RegionOne" os_domain_name: "Default" And so on. This is definitely valid syntax, and when the variables are used in the playbook, they're translated like the following: - name: creating new instances and attaching to declared networks os_server: state: present auth: auth_url: "{{ auth.os_auth_url }}" username: "{{ auth.os_username }}" password: "{{ os_password }}" project_name: "{{ project.os_project }}" name: "{{ instance.os_hostname }}" image: "{{ instance.os_image_id }}" key_name: "{{ instance.os_key_name }}" timeout: 200 flavor: "{{ instance.os_flavor_id }}" network: "{{ network.os_network_id }}" meta: hostname: "{{ meta.os_hostname }}" group: "{{ meta.os_group }}" This works perfectly fine (as expected) when running manually. However, I'm starting to PoC AWX for our use, before deciding to purchase a Tower support contract. Unfortunately, when trying to use these same variables in surveys, I receive an error that states "Please remove the illegal character from the survey question variable name". This occurs because AWX is not interpreting the "." as a valid element. Can someone tell me if there's a work around, or do I need to redraft my playbooks (I would really like to avoid this if possible). Thanks for the help/guidance in advance!
